Is Sister Joy really a Pokémon?

At the sub -peddit to Pokémon, a hair-raising fan theory is currently circulating over sister Joy. All instructions indicate that the identical nurses are actually Pokémon of the same species .

Redditor Exgshadow justifies its steep thesis as follows:

1. Argument: There are several identical versions of it around the world.

Again and again, Ash on his journey begins new specimens of sister Joy. Although it is another one, but distinguishes the nurses do not differ. Both in the occurrence, as well as in the look and their votes - as well as a Pokémon.

2 . Argument: There is even a shiny shape.

3 . Argument: and also an alola form (as well as other regional forms).

4 . Argument: If you multiply, the descendants become the same species as their mother.

When breeding Pokémon, the descendants take on the species of the mother. A scene in the anime clearly shows that also the child looks like a sister Joy as well as you.

The case should be clear, right?

What do fans say to theory?

In the comments on the reddit thread, it goes under it and over. Some suggests the sister joy theory that is also Officer Rocky a Pokémon. She also meets Ash dozens of Male in the world of Pokémon.

Although there is an official justification, according to which the police officers simply be all cousins, but fans mean: This explanation serves only for cover-up. Nobody should learn the truth about the Poké policewoman.

Others become more precise in their theories of sister Joy and writing that they could also be a ditto.

THW Kiel brings European champion Eric Johansson

A day after the Champions League victory against Elverum, the record champion Kiel has proclaimed the obligation of Eric Johansson from the Norwegian Master. The Swedish European champion signed a three-year contract at THW from the coming season. "He is one of the largest talents of Europe, despite his young years already a service provider in a Champions League participant and willing to grow better and better," said THW Managing Director Viktor Szilagyi over the 21-year-old backpart player. On Thursday evening, the Kieler had won in the race for the direct quarterfinal movement 31:30 (14:15) at Norway's Master Elverum. Johansson achieved eight goals as the best thrower of his team against his future employer. "I want to continue to develop handball and I'm ready for this next big step in my career," said the ten-time national player.
